Licensing Requirements

To become a licensed private investigator in Florida, we must meet specific requirements set by the state. Education and training are crucial aspects of obtaining a license. The state mandates that aspiring private investigators complete a minimum of 40 hours of professional training from a recognized educational institution. This training covers various topics such as legal principles, ethics, surveillance techniques, and report writing. Additionally, individuals must pass a state-administered examination to demonstrate their knowledge and competency in the field.

Setting Up Your Office

Once the licensing requirements are met, we can proceed to establish our physical office for the private investigation business. Setting up our workspace is a crucial step that requires careful consideration. The right office layout and equipment can greatly enhance our efficiency and productivity.

First and foremost, we need to choose a suitable location for our office. It should be easily accessible to our clients and have ample parking space. Additionally, the office should be situated in a professional environment that aligns with the image we want to portray to our clients.

When it comes to choosing the right equipment, we must prioritize functionality and security. A reliable computer system with high-speed internet access is essential for conducting online research and managing our cases efficiently. We should also invest in a good quality printer, scanner, and copier to handle various documentation needs.

To ensure the confidentiality of our clients’ information, it’s imperative to have a secure filing system. We should consider investing in a locking file cabinet or a digital storage solution with encryption capabilities.
